      Summary: By using the fixed point theorem and constructing a Lyapunov functional, we establish some sufficient conditions on the existence, uniqueness, and exponential stability of equilibrium point for a class of fuzzy BAM neural networks with infinitely distributed delays and impulses on time scales. We also present a numerical example to show the feasibility of obtained results. Our example also shows that the described time and continuous neural time networks have the same dynamic behaviours for the stability.
